The reproduction below of Caravaggio's Love Victorious (the original Caravaggio painting is held in Berlin, Staatliche Museum) is another Caravaggio painting by Sergei. Those who believed that Caravaggio was a homosexual interpret the figure of Love in an erotic vein: the painter's "favourite" must have posed for him with complacent licentiousness. As a matter of fact, the splayed legs hark back to a symbolic code also used by Michelangelo to signify resurrection, victory and triumph.

1. Caravaggio Paintings: Supper in Emmaus by Alex for Fabulous Masterpieces

This painting, the original, which is in our very own National Gallery (London) unmistakably demonstrates Caravaggio's love for symbolism.  This disciple with his arms outstretched (as if to measure space) recognizes his Lord and mimes in his gesture the shape of the cross.  The basket of fruit also contains grapes and pomegranates, common symbols of Christ's martyrdom.
